Les deux fonctions sont assez simple. Tout d'abord, assurez-vous qu'il est judicieux de déplacer l'entrée (si il ya une seule valeur, alors il n'y a aucun sens à essayer de le déplacer) et assurez-vous que l'utilisateur a sélectionné une entrée. Deuxièmement, assurez-vous que l'article peut être déplacé (le premier article ne peut pas être déplacé vers le haut, le dernier élément ne peut pas être déplacé vers le bas). Si l'élément peut être déplacé, puis échanger le texte et la valeur avec son voisin correcte. C'est tout. Voici la fonction «passer à la liste"
javax.
microedition.midlet d'importation. *;.
javax.microedition.lcdui d'importation *;
/**
*author umesh
* /
listmoveupdown public class étend MIDlet implémente CommandListener {
private int sélectionné;
affichage d'affichage privé;
Commande cmdmoveup = nouveau commandement ("monter", Command.OK, 1);
insert de commande = nouveau commandement ("insérer", Command.OK, 1);
< p> addPage de commande = new Command ("insérer", Command.OK, 1);
commande DELETE = nouveau commandement ("supprimer", Command.
OK, 1);
Liste abc = new List ("", List.IMPLICIT); pages de formulaire = nouveau formulaire ("" ); Liste pagelist = new List ("", List.IMPLICIT); vide startApp () { affichage public = display.getDisplay (this); pagelist.append ("p1", null); pagelist.append ("P2", null); pagelist.append ("P3", null); pagelist.append ("p4", null); pagelist.append ("P5", null); pagelist. setCommandListener (this); pagelist.addCommand (addPage); abc.append ("Urvi", null); abc.append ("abcd", null); abc.append ("Kruti", null); abc.append ("UMESH", null); abc.append ("XYZU", null); abc.addCommand (cmdmoveup); abc.addCommand (cmdmovedown); abc.addCommand (insert); abc.addCommand (supprimer); abc.setCommandListener (this); Display.getDisplay (cette) .setCurrent (abc); } listpress public void () < p> { Chaîne x = pagelist.getString (pagelist. getSelectedIndex ()); abc.append (x, null); display.setCurrent (abc) ; } vides pauseApp () { } moveUpList public void Introduction à la programmation Sybase SQL pour Events